    this probably seems trivial, but how do you ensure your website is the right size? I have been building my site on a pc with a large screen, and now when I preview the site on another computer I find I need to scroll from left to right to see al the info. How can I avoid this?
    Is there a "set size" for web pages, or can I somehow make sure my web pages resize the;selves?

    Buid your site between 800 & 1024px. This will satisfy the majority of visitors.

    You can change this width in page properties and also select centre in browser horizontally.

    When building your pages in BV always work from the left and keep within your page width.
